Overview

IQVIA’s Financial Institutions Consulting (FIC) team advises investors (e.g. private equity, venture capital, hedge funds, etc.) on biopharma and life sciences investments, including commercial due diligence, asset and target screening, portfolio company growth strategy and exit/divestment strategy.

Successful candidates will have the opportunity to engage with clients on high-profile investment decisions across a variety of industry-shaping transaction situations, business models and strategic issues. We operate in a multi-cultural, collaborative and fast-paced work environment, that is rich in development and growth.

Role & Responsibilities

As a Manager within IQVIA’s FIC team, you will be responsible for managing projects primarily in the areas of due diligence (buy- and sell-side), asset/portfolio/company valuation, asset screening and growth strategy

  • Leverage consulting and transaction advisory experience, IQVIA information and expertise, and methodological know-how to manage projects that address client / business questions.
  • Diagnose and understand complex strategic issues / diligence questions and structure project approach and team setup to address engagement objectives
  • Manage project teams on a day-to-day basis through guiding research approaches, the design, development and delivery of client reports and presentations and QC of deliverables
  • Serve as day-to-day point of contact with clients during project delivery – including presenting / communicating key project insights and recommendations – ensuring engagement satisfaction and supporting long-term enhancement of client relationships
  • Contribute to overall FIC team capabilities, including (but not limited to) the development of intellectual property, marketing materials, training, recruitment and go-to-market approach
  • Support Principals with business development, including proposal development and presentations.
  • Serve as development lead of 3-4 team members, alongside supporting broader team development

About You

Candidates interested in joining IQVIA FIC as a Manager should have:

  • Minimum of 5-6 years professional experience in strategy consulting, M&A/BD&L roles or within a financial institution (e.g. private equity, venture capital).
  • Experience advising clients on commercial issues in the biopharma / life sciences industry and/or financial investors, including exposure to projects related to transactions / investments (due diligence, valuation, asset identification, growth strategy, forecasting)
  • Project management experience in relevant domains, including managing large, multi-disciplined teams while maintaining high quality delivery. Demonstrated skills including project planning, workstream oversight, presentation/report development, quality control and client engagement
  • Strong quantitative / analytical and qualitative research experience, supported by a problem solving mentality, keen eye for detail and critical thinking. Comfortable interpreting commercial / financial trends and results, with ability to guide teams to design and execute research and analysis and translate outputs into strategic implications for investors
  • Well-developed written and verbal communication skills including presentations, chairing meetings / Q&A sessions and report writing
  • Knowledge of key issues and current developments in the biopharma / life sciences industry
  • Evidence of career progression in consulting and/or transaction advisory roles

In addition to the skills and experience above, a Manager should have:

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ent. MBA not required but a plus
  • A track record of leadership and people development
  • Fluency in English (spoken and written)
  • A willingness and ability to travel (where required)
  • Right to live and work in the recruiting country
